    The T and C is the toploader... If you have a T-10 thats no good to you.

    I think the Compe***ion Plus is well worth the difference if you like banging gears, just get rid of the Nylon bushings for the steel or aluminum ones....

    I had a similar problem with my 64 Falcon and I ended up having to make a custom set-up from a Mustang Compe***ion Plus.

    The Falcon shifter mounts farther forward on the tailshaft than other units,right up against the main case. With the toploader I know that unless something changed the Falcon kit is no longer sold new and they bring a very good price.

    I'm not sure on a T-10 maybe a kit is the same from something else. Otherwise the T-10 is not really as popular with Ford guys since the toploader is so much stronger, with that I doubt it still around either.

    If no one offers anything better, see if you can get any placement information on those kits you have posted, the shortest one is your best bet.
